Geotechnical Engineer

SMEUSA is seeking a Geotechnical Engineer to assist clients in executing their projects through various field-centric duties. The role involves evaluating soils, coordinating with clients and subcontractors, and preparing geotechnical proposals and reports under the supervision of Professional Engineers.

Responsibilities

Evaluation of soils for bearing capacity, subgrade modulus, seismic site classification, lateral earth pressures, analysis of laboratory test data and results, pressuremeter analysis, slope stability analysis, deep foundation design and other related geotechnical engineering topics
Work closely in coordinating with clients, subcontractors, and other SME team members
Prepare geotechnical proposals and reports
Collaboration of scopes of work and recommendations with senior level engineers
Use your problem-solving skills to identify and resolve complex challenges
